⭐️ Thinking partner for ideas Tool: Cursor (Plan/Ask mode) I use Plan mode to discuss a feature/design: “what am I missing?”, “what can go wrong?”, “what’s the simplest version?”, “how should I break this into steps?”, “How can we implement this?”,
⭐️ Finding edge cases Tool: Claude (Opus-4.6) I paste the context (API, flow, PR description) and ask it to list edge cases: retries, timeouts, caching, permissions, weird inputs, etc. Opus works great for any code related tasks.
⭐️ Code review before the code review Tool: CodeRabbit, GitHub Copilot, Cursor Review These tools are really great to get a review before asking for a human review. I use them on all of my PRs.
⭐️ Turning manual processes into clean steps Tool: ChatGPT / Claude This is usually a back-and-forth conversation until it becomes a clean checklist/runbook and sometimes an automation script.
⭐️ Writing clearer communication Tool: Any AI works, but I mostly use ChatGPT PR descriptions, Slack updates, incident notes — it helps turn messy thoughts into clear writing.
